The Disposal of Real Properties of Delinquent Taxpayers Ordinance of 2017

August 29, 2017 MANDALUYONG CITY ORDINANCE NO. 672-17 ORDINANCE PROVIDING FOR THE DISPOSAL OF REAL PROPERTIES OF DELINQUENT TAXPAYERS IN THE CITY OF MANDALUYONG BY PUBLIC AUCTION WHEREAS, the Local Government Code of 1991 provides that each local government unit has the power to create their own sources of revenues and to levy taxes, fees, and charges which shall accrue exclusively for their use and disposition, and to acquire, develop, lease, encumber, alienate, or otherwise, dispose of real or personal property held by them in their proprietary capacity and to apply their resources and assets for productive, developmental, or welfare purposes, in the exercise or furtherance of their governmental or proprietary powers and functions; WHEREAS, every owner of real property in the City of Mandaluyong or any person having legal interest thereon shall pay the basic real property tax and additional tax for Special Education Fund (SEF) on or before the thirty-first (31st) day of January each year or on any other date/s as may be prescribed by the Sanggunian without interest or penalty being incurred; WHEREAS, in case of failure to pay the basic real property tax and other tax imposed when they become due, the delinquent real property, after notice, will be sold at public auction, and title will be vested in the purchaser without prejudice to the exercise of the right of redemption; WHEREAS, to ensure sustainable development of the City of Mandaluyong and the delivery of basic services and facilities to all Mandaleos, stringent measures should be put in place to collect such taxes, fees and charges that are due and demandable; WHEREAS, to inculcate discipline in its citizenry on this basic obligation, real properties of delinquent taxpayers in Mandaluyong City shall be disposed through public auction, subject to existing laws, rules and regulations as well as this Ordinance. NOW, THEREFORE, be it ORDAINED by the Sangguniang Panlungsod of the City of Mandaluyong, in regular session assembled that: SECTION 1. Title . This Ordinance shall be known as "The Disposal of Real Properties of Delinquent Taxpayers Ordinance of 2017" of Mandaluyong City. SECTION 2. Declaration of Policy . It is the declared policy of the City of Mandaluyong to intensify its revenue collection efforts and to provide stiffer penalties for tax delinquencies to encourage the taxpayers to pay taxes, fees and other charges on time. SECTION 3. Public Auction of Real Properties of Delinquent Taxpayers . Any and all real properties, including condominium units, located within the City of Mandaluyong found to be delinquent in the payment of real property taxes, fees and other charges for a period of at least four (4) years shall be sold in a public auction to be conducted by the City Treasurer in the manner herein provided, and the title to the real property of delinquent taxpayer shall be vested in the purchaser subject, however, to the exercise of the right of redemption within one (1) year from date of the sale. SECTION 4. Notice of Delinquency . Upon the real property tax, fees and other charges becoming delinquent, the City Treasurer shall immediately prepare and serve a Notice of Delinquency against the owner of the real property. In addition, the Notice of Delinquency shall be posted at the main hall and in a publicly accessible and conspicuous place in each barangay of Mandaluyong City. It shall also be published once a week for two (2) consecutive weeks, in a newspaper of general circulation in the City. SECTION 5. Contents of the Notice of Delinquency . The Notice of Delinquency to be issued by the City Treasurer shall contain the amount of the taxes, penalties, dues and other charges due the real property; the date, time and place of sale; the name of the owner or owners of the property against whom the tax was assessed; the nature of the property and, if land, its approximate area and location stating the street and block number, district or barangay, where that property to be sold is situated. SECTION 6. Payment of Delinquency before the Sale . At any time during or before the sale, the delinquent taxpayers may stay all proceedings by paying the taxes, penalties, dues and other charges including the costs of sale due at the time of tender to the City Treasurer or his deputy conducting the sale. SECTION 7. City Treasurer to Buy Property . In case there is no bidder at the public auction of the real property of delinquent taxpayer, or if the highest bid is for an amount not sufficient to pay taxes, penalties, dues and other charges, including the costs of sale, the City Treasurer shall buy the real property in the name of the City of Mandaluyong for the amount of taxes, penalties, dues and other charges due thereon, and the costs of sale. SECTION 8. Certificate of Sale to be Issued . The purchaser at the public auction of the real property shall receive from the City Treasurer a Certificate of Sale setting forth the proceedings had at the sale, a description of the property sold the name of the purchaser, the sale price, as well as the exact amount of the taxes and penalties due and the costs of sale. The person in whose name the property is listed and assessed shall be furnished with a copy of Certificate of Sale. SECTION 9. Registration of the Certificate of Sale . The purchaser of the real property at the public auction shall register the Certificate of Sale issued by the City Treasurer with the appropriate Register of Deeds. SECTION 10. Redemption after Sale . Within a period of one (1) year counted from the date of registration of the Certificate of Sale, the delinquent taxpayer or his authorized representative, or in their absence, any person holding a lien or claim over the property, shall have the right to redeem the property upon payment to the City Treasurer of the amount of the delinquent tax, including the interest due thereon, and the expenses of sale from the date of delinquency to the date of sale, plus interest of not more than two percent (2%) per month on the purchase price from the date of sale to the date of redemption. Such payment shall invalidate the Certificate of Sale issued to the purchaser and the owner of the real property or person having legal interest therein shall be entitled to a Certificate of Redemption which shall be issued by the City Treasurer or his deputy. From the date of sale until the expiration of the period of redemption, the real property shall remain in possession of the owner or person having legal interest therein who shall be entitled to the income and other fruits thereof. The City Treasurer or his deputy, upon receipt from the purchaser of the Certificate of Sale, shall forthwith return to the latter the entire amount paid by him plus interest of not more than two percent (2%) per month. Thereafter, the property shall be free from lien of such delinquent tax, interest due thereon and expenses of sale. SECTION 11. Final Deed to Purchaser . In case the owner or person having legal interest fails to redeem the delinquent property as provided herein, the City Treasurer shall execute a deed conveying to the purchaser said property, free from lien of the delinquent tax, interest due thereon and expenses of sale. The deed shall briefly state the proceedings upon which the validity of the sale rests. SECTION 12. Registration of the Final Deed to Purchaser . The final deed conveying to the purchaser said property shall be registered with the appropriate Register of Deeds who shall cause the cancellation of the title in the name of the delinquent taxpayer and the issuance of a new title in the name of the purchaser in the public auction. SECTION 13. Writ of Possession . After consolidation of title in the name of the purchaser in the public auction, the latter may ask to be placed in possession of subject property through the appropriate action provided for by existing law. SECTION 14. Separability Clause . If, for any reason or reasons, any part or provision of this Ordinance shall be held to be unconstitutional or invalid, other parts or provisions hereof which are not affected thereby shall continue to be in full force and effect. SECTION 15. Effectivity . This Ordinance shall take effect fifteen (15) days after its complete publication in a newspaper of general circulation.
